PreVeil is a fast-growing, profitable SaaS company providing best-in-class encrypted email and file sharing for organizations that handle sensitive data. We’ve been named a Best Place to Work three years in a row and recognized by PC Magazine as the best encrypted email and file-sharing platform for five consecutive years.


Beyond security, PreVeil helps defense contractors meet strict U.S. federal cybersecurity compliance requirements—most notably the Cybersecurity Maturity Model Certification (CMMC), which is required to do business with the Department of Defense. More than 2,500 defense customers rely on PreVeil, and over 60 have successfully achieved certification, placing PreVeil among the most proven platforms in this space.

We’re seeking a hands-on Lead Software Engineer, Client Systems, to build and evolve software that runs on customer endpoints and securely coordinates with PreVeil’s cloud services. This is not a traditional web frontend or backend API-only role. The work spans local state, file-system integration, networking, synchronization, identity, reliability, and secure protocols across Windows and macOS, with supporting web and cloud services.


Strong candidates may come from desktop applications, endpoint security, embedded or device-to-cloud systems, file synchronization, collaboration software, developer tools, or other technically complex client environments. We value strong computer science fundamentals and experience solving difficult production problems more than experience with any specific programming language.

Our Technology Environment

PreVeil currently uses Python and Go across core services, C++ for portions of the Windows client, Swift and native tooling on macOS, web technologies for browser-based clients, and SQL/SQLite for relational and local storage. Direct experience with these technologies is helpful but not required.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
